6.11.2023 | It's only been four years since Finland's natural gas imports were entirely dependent on the Russian pipeline connection. At the beginning of 2020, the Balticconnector between Finland and Estonia was commissioned, and a year ago, in the conditions of energy crisis, so was the floating LNG terminal in Inkoo. In an amazingly short time, Finland has changed gas monopoly to global LNG market. After ...https://tem.fi/en/-/radical-events-in-the-finnish-gas-market-security-of-supply-ensured

18.9.2024 | The increase in variable renewable electricity generation has increased the variation in the supply available on the market, and as a result, affected security of supply and increased the fluctuation in electricity prices. Generation may vary significantly within days, between days and at different seasons, sometimes unpredictably.https://tem.fi/en/-/working-group-to-explore-ways-to-promote-security-of-supply-and-flexibility-of-electricity-market
